Cell

/sɛl/ · noun

Meaning

A single-room dwelling for a hermit..

Definitions by Sense

  1. A single-room dwelling for a hermit.
  2. (now historical) A small monastery or nunnery dependent on a larger religious establishment.
  3. A small room in a monastery or nunnery accommodating one person.
  4. A room in a prison or jail for one or more inmates.
  5. Each of the small hexagonal compartments in a honeycomb.
  6. (biology, now chiefly botany) Any of various chambers in a tissue or organism having specific functions.
  7. (entomology) The discal cell of the wing of a lepidopteran insect.
  8. (obsolete) Specifically, any of the supposed compartments of the brain, formerly thought to be the source of specific mental capacities, knowledge, or memories.
